The Top 12 Data Breaches of 2019

Maria henriquez 200px
Maria Henriquez
December 5, 2019
Just in 2018, there were 500 million personal records stolen. How many records will be stolen by year’s end? According to the RiskBased Data Breach QuickView Report 2019 Q3, at the end of September, there were 5,183 breaches, exposing 7.9 billion records. Compared to the 2018 Q3 report, the total number of breaches was up 33.3 percent and the total number of records exposed more than doubled, up 112 percent.

A Resilient Answer to Disasters

Ray rothrock
Ray Rothrock
December 5, 2019
Both disaster recovery and business continuity are answers to what happens when entropy strikes, things fall apart, and business is interrupted. Resilience is strategy using a set of tools and approaches that make it harder for things to fall apart, and easier and faster to put them back together when they do.

CISA Informs the Financial Sector on Dridex Malware

December 5, 2019
The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A) recently published an alert on the Dridex malware, as the result of recent collaboration between the Department of the Treasury Financial Sector Cyber Information Group (CIG) and the Department of the Treasury’s Financial Crimes Enforcement Network (FinCEN) to identify and share information with the financial services sector.
